Core RC have introduced the Code 2.4GHz Digital Proportional R/C System, which has been designed for UK racers brought up on a long tradition of twin stick radio configuration. It offers a whole host of features designed for maximum functionality and ease of use and there is now no need to worry about the frequencies of your buddies, the 2.4GHz takes car of that. With its list of high end features, it may look like they come from a £300+ radio but the Core RC Code costs just a fraction of that, retailing at £90 and coming supplied with a small 3 channel receiver that is small enough to be used in almost any application.

Features:
- 2.4 GHz
- 3 Channel
- Servo Reverse
- EPA Settings
- Steering Rate
- Throttle Rate
- Steering Trim
- Throttle Trim
- Steering Sub Trim
- Throttle Sub Trim
- Steering Speed
- Throttle Speed
- Brake ABS
- Throttle Curve
- Steering Curve
- ATS Launch Control
- 15 Model Memory
- Brake ATL
- Throttle Hold
- Timer
- Servo Monitor
- Charging Jack
